WebApr 14, 2024 · Brno, Apr 13 (BD) – Scientists from the Faculty of Agriculture at Mendel University are carrying out tests on a closed farming cycle. In cooperation with a Czech producer of organic food, the experts are developing a new functional food. They plan to turn the waste from the production into a soil substrate and part of the feed for pigs or ... WebApr 1, 2015 · The increasing negative effects on food safety from water and soil pollution have put more people at risk of carcinogenic diseases, potentially contributing to ‘cancer villages’. Currently in China integrated food safety policies are rare from the perspective of soil and water pollution. Future policies need to address this and integrate ...
